The Effect of Steroids on an Athlete’s Cardiovascular System

19 de maio de 2025
in Outros

In the world of competitive sports, performance-enhancing drugs such as anabolic steroids have gained notoriety for their ability to improve strength, endurance, and muscle mass. However, these substances can pose serious health risks, especially concerning the cardiovascular system. Understanding how steroids influence heart health is crucial for athletes, coaches, healthcare professionals, and anyone considering their use.

What Are Anabolic Steroids?

Anabolic steroids are synthetic variations of the male hormone testosterone. They promote muscle growth and enhance physical performance by increasing protein synthesis within cells. While prescribed medically for certain conditions, non-medical use among athletes is widespread due to the desire for quick performance gains.

Impact of Steroids on the Cardiovascular System

The effects of steroids extend beyond muscle development; they significantly impact cardiovascular health in various ways. The following sections detail the primary mechanisms through which steroids influence the heart and blood vessels.

Alteration of Lipid Profiles

One of the most well-documented effects of anabolic steroids is their ability to modify lipid levels in the blood:

  • Increase in LDL Cholesterol: Steroids tend to elevate low-density lipoprotein (LDL), commonly known as “bad” cholesterol, which contributes to plaque formation in arteries.
  • Decrease in HDL Cholesterol: Simultaneously, they reduce high-density lipoprotein (HDL), or “good” cholesterol, impairing the body’s ability to remove fats from the bloodstream.

This imbalance in cholesterol levels fosters atherosclerosis—a buildup of fats and other substances in artery walls—raising the risk of heart attacks and strokes.

Hypertension (High Blood Pressure)

Steroid use can lead to an increase in blood pressure through several mechanisms:

  • Fluid and sodium retention caused by steroids expand blood volume.
  • Vasoconstriction, or narrowing of blood vessels, raises peripheral resistance.
  • Altered kidney function impacts fluid regulation.

Persistent hypertension strains the heart, increases the likelihood of hypertrophy (thickening of the heart muscle), and predisposes individuals to adverse cardiovascular events.

Myocardial Hypertrophy and Structural Changes

Chronic steroid use can induce myocardial hypertrophy, an abnormal thickening of the heart muscle, particularly affecting the left ventricle. While moderate hypertrophy may initially enhance cardiac output, excessive thickening compromises heart flexibility and function, leading to diastolic dysfunction and increased risk of heart failure.

Arrhythmias and Cardiac Risk

Electrolyte imbalances resulting from steroid use, combined with structural changes, can predispose athletes to irregular heart rhythms or arrhythmias. These disturbances can be life-threatening, especially during intense physical exertion.

Thrombosis and Clot Formation

Some steroids increase platelet aggregation, heightening the risk of blood clots. Thrombosis can obstruct coronary arteries, precipitating myocardial infarction (heart attack).

Additional Factors Contributing to Cardiovascular Risks

Beyond direct effects, steroids may indirectly contribute to cardiovascular disease through:

  1. Behavioral Changes: Enhanced aggression and risk-taking behaviors may lead to neglect of health or unsafe activities.
  2. Altered Lipid Metabolism: Long-term disruptions can accelerate atherosclerosis progression.
  3. Impaired Endothelial Function: Steroids can damage the lining of blood vessels, impairing vasodilation and promoting inflammation.

Long-Term Consequences and Risks

Prolonged or high-dose steroid use amplifies cardiovascular risks, potentially resulting in irreversible damage. These include:

  • Premature coronary artery disease
  • Chronic hypertension
  • Heart failure
  • Sudden cardiac death
